Rebel TMC faction replaces Mamata Banerjee as chairperson, picks Arup Roy
Bhubaneswar, June 22 -- A major power struggle has erupted within the Trinamool Congress (TMC) after a dissident group of party leaders and legislators appointed senior MLA Arup Roy as the chairperson of what they termed the 'real' TMC, directly challenging the leadership of party founder Mamata Banerjee.
The rebel camp, headed by Leader of the Opposition Ritabrata Banerjee, also announced the suspension of national general secretary Abhishek Banerjee and unveiled a parallel organisational structure, indicating that the revolt has expanded beyond the legislature into the party's organisational framework.
